Title 22 › Chapter 34— THE PEACE CORPS › § 2507f
The President must create and put in place a full stalking policy for the Peace Corps. The policy must make the Peace Corps respond right away and fully when someone reports stalking, give every volunteer during training a person or office to contact about stalking, and keep reporters’ information private as much as possible. The President must get advice from stalking experts and train all in-country staff on the policy.
